Output 028e595406e35167a2f40fb516b4b0ea59b71d17af9ef7e58745260b79701e16:4

value
659214
script pubkey
OP_0 OP_PUSHBYTES_20 bd373fd05e204cf1ec5ca2bb35c6b4088d53cfaa
address
bc1qh5mnl5z7ypx0rmzu52ant345pzx48na2gycc49
transaction
028e595406e35167a2f40fb516b4b0ea59b71d17af9ef7e58745260b79701e16